Great stain remover and gets rid of the yellowing on vintage garments!
My Mom actually turned me onto this particular bar soap for getting stains out of garments, no matter the color and so far it has really worked for me!It’s especially great for getting rid of old pit stains and any yellowing of white fabrics on vintage dresses.Here’s how I use the soap.I fill the tub with cold water and soak the garment. I rub the soap into the stained or yellowed portion for about 5 minutes, then I wash it out to see how bad the staining or yellowing still is. If it’s really bad, I rub soap into the stained area again, then I lift that portion out of the bath and place it on the edge so that the soap can fully dry out on it.After I let it dry for 2-5 hours, I rinse, and usually the armpit staining is gone, sometimes it takes a couple of tries with garments that have harsh yellowing from age.If it’s REALLY bad, I let the soap dry overnight then I rinse it out and 9 times out of 10 it looks like new!This works great on newer stains as well, though it does not work with rust stains, for that I use Rust Off.I recently used this on a dark teal vintage dress with a large yellowed white collar and it got all the yellowing out which I think is amazing considering the dress is over 60 years old.Another great thing about this is that it didn’t fade the teal of the dress!You do have to use cold water though.If you use hot, the colors may bleed or fade.I wouldn’t use this to wash my body because it leaves a film on the tub that I assume would be left on my body as well, which is why I took off a star.Also, after using it my hands are EXTRA dry which probably would not be a pleasant feeling on my entire body.🤷🏽♀️That said, it’s great as a stain remover, though the smell is a little strong for my taste.
